.menu-mobile--open,.menu-mobile--opening,.menu-mobile--closing,.menu-mobile--open .transition-body,.menu-mobile--opening .transition-body,.menu-mobile--closing .transition-body{overflow:hidden}.menu-mobile--open .transition-content,.menu-mobile--opening .transition-content,.menu-mobile--closing .transition-content,.menu-mobile--open .header-wrapper,.menu-mobile--opening .header-wrapper,.menu-mobile--closing .header-wrapper,.menu-mobile--open .announcement-bar,.menu-mobile--opening .announcement-bar,.menu-mobile--closing .announcement-bar{padding-inline-end:var(--scrollbar-width)}.menu-mobile--open .transition-body:after,.menu-mobile--opening .transition-body:after{opacity:1;pointer-events:visible}.menu-mobile--open .shopify-section-header-sticky,.menu-mobile--opening .shopify-section-header-sticky,.menu-mobile--closing .shopify-section-header-sticky{min-height:var(--header-height)}.menu-mobile--open .shopify-section-header-sticky .header-wrapper,.menu-mobile--opening .shopify-section-header-sticky .header-wrapper,.menu-mobile--closing .shopify-section-header-sticky .header-wrapper{position:fixed;top:0;left:0;width:100%}.menu-mobile--open #MainContent,.menu-mobile--open #shopify-section-footer,.menu-mobile--opening #MainContent,.menu-mobile--opening #shopify-section-footer{transform:translate(4rem)}.menu-mobile--open #shopify-section-announcement-bar,.menu-mobile--opening #shopify-section-announcement-bar,.menu-mobile--closing #shopify-section-announcement-bar{position:relative;z-index:100}.menu-mobile--open #shopify-section-header:not(.shopify-section-header-sticky),.menu-mobile--opening #shopify-section-header:not(.shopify-section-header-sticky),.menu-mobile--closing #shopify-section-header:not(.shopify-section-header-sticky){position:relative;z-index:99}.menu-drawer-container{position:static}.menu-trigger{background:none;border:none;padding:0;cursor:pointer}.menu-drawer-container.menu-open .menu-drawer{transform:translate(0);visibility:visible}.menu-drawer{position:absolute;transform:translate(-100%);visibility:hidden;z-index:var(--z-index-drawer);left:0;top:0;width:100%;padding:0;background-color:rgb(var(--colors_sidebar_menu_bg_mb));overflow-x:hidden}.js .menu-drawer{border-top:1px solid var(--color-grey-200)}.js .shopify-section-header-sticky.shopify-section-header-hidden .menu-drawer{height:100vh}.js details[open]>.menu-drawer,.js details[open]>.menu-drawer__submenu{transition-property:transform,visibility;transition-duration:var(--duration-long);transition-timing-function:ease}.no-js details[open]>.menu-drawer,.js details[open].menu-opening>.menu-drawer,details[open].menu-opening>.menu-drawer__submenu{transform:translate(0);opacity:0}@media screen and (max-width: 1299px){.no-js details[open]>.menu-drawer,.js details[open].menu-opening>.menu-drawer,details[open].menu-opening>.menu-drawer__submenu{visibility:visible;opacity:1}}@media screen and (min-width: 750px){.menu-drawer{width:45rem}.no-js .menu-drawer{height:auto}}.menu-drawer__inner-container{position:relative;height:calc(100vh - var(--announcement-bar-height) - var(--space-lg))}.menu-drawer__navigation-container{display:grid;grid-template-rows:1fr auto;align-content:space-between;height:100%;overflow-y:auto;scrollbar-width:thin}.menu-drawer__navigation{overflow-x:hidden}.menu-drawer__menu>li .menu-drawer__menu-item{position:relative;font:var(--h6-font-mobile);letter-spacing:var(--h6-letter-spacing);display:block;margin:0 var(--space-md);border-bottom:1px solid var(--color-grey-200)}.menu-drawer__menu>li .menu-drawer__menu-item .icon-caret{position:absolute;right:0;top:50%;transform:translateY(-50%) rotate(-90deg)}.menu-drawer__menu-item-main{flex-direction:row!important;justify-content:flex-start!important;text-align:left}.menu-drawer__menu-item-main .icon-caret{margin-left:auto;transform:rotate(-90deg);width:var(--icon-size-s);height:var(--icon-size-s)}.menu-drawer__menu-item-main>.media{width:48px;height:48px;margin-right:12px;border-radius:5px}.menu-drawer__menu .accordion{margin:0;border:0}.menu-drawer__menu .accordion summary,.menu-drawer__menu .accordion .summary{padding:0}.menu-drawer__menu .summary.active svg{transform:rotate(0)}.menu-drawer__inner-submenu{height:100%;overflow-x:auto;overflow-y:hidden}.menu-drawer__inner-submenu .list-menu{display:flex;width:fit-content;padding:0 27px;gap:10px}.menu-drawer__inner-submenu lazy-image{width:100%;height:120px;margin-bottom:16px}.menu-drawer__inner-submenu .menu-drawer__menu li{padding-right:20px}.menu-drawer__inner-submenu .menu-drawer__menu a{text-decoration:none}.menu-drawer__inner-submenu .menu-drawer__menu-item{font-size:11px;line-height:16px;margin:0;padding:0!important}.menu-drawer__inner-submenu .menu-drawer__menu-item span{align-self:flex-start;flex:1}.menu-drawer__inner-submenu .menu-drawer__menu-item svg.icon-caret{display:block}.menu-drawer__inner-submenu li:first-child .menu-drawer__menu-item{padding-top:0}.menu-drawer__inner-submenu li{display:flex;flex-direction:column;width:105px;padding:16px 0}.menu-drawer__inner-submenu li>.menu-drawer__menu-item{width:100%}.no-js .menu-drawer__navigation{padding:0}.no-js .menu-drawer__submenu ul{border-bottom:.1rem solid rgb(var(--color-border))}.menu-drawer__menu-item{flex:0 0 100%;padding:16px 0;text-decoration:none;text-transform:uppercase;display:flex;align-items:center;flex-direction:column;justify-content:space-between;cursor:pointer}.menu-drawer__menu>li:last-child>.menu-drawer__menu-item,.menu-drawer__menu>li:last-child>details>summary>.menu-drawer__menu-item{border-bottom:0}.no-js .menu-drawer__menu-item{font-size:1.6rem}.no-js .menu-drawer__submenu .menu-drawer__submenu .menu-drawer__menu-item{padding-inline-start:9rem}.no-js .menu-drawer__menu-item .icon-caret{right:3rem}.menu-drawer .icon-arrow{height:1.5rem;width:1.5rem;margin-inline-end:3rem}.menu-drawer .icon-arrow-up{height:6px;width:10px;margin-inline-end:18px;transform:rotate(180deg)}.js .menu-drawer__submenu{position:absolute;top:0;width:100%;height:100%;left:0;background-color:rgb(var(--colors_submenu_bg_mb));z-index:10;transform:translate(100%);visibility:hidden;transition:transform .3s ease,visibility .3s ease;overflow-y:auto}.js .menu-drawer__submenu--third{z-index:11}.js .menu-drawer__submenu.active{transform:translate(0);visibility:visible}.menu-drawer__topbar{display:flex;border-bottom:.1rem solid var(--color-grey-200);height:60px}.no-js .menu-drawer__topbar{display:none}.menu-drawer__close-button{position:absolute;display:block;transform:rotate(180deg);padding:0;border:none;background-color:transparent;color:rgb(var(--color-link));z-index:var(--z-index-dropdown);width:var(--icon-size-l);height:var(--icon-size-l);right:20px;top:20px}.menu-drawer__close-button svg{margin-inline-end:0!important;height:var(--icon-size-l)}.menu-drawer__topbar .header__heading-link{padding:0}.menu-drawer__topbar .header__heading-link img{width:auto;height:auto;max-width:100%;max-height:var(--image-logo-height);padding-left:var(--space-md);position:relative;top:50%;transform:translateY(-50%)}.menu-drawer__topbar .menu-drawer__menu-item{flex:1 1 auto;display:flex;align-items:center;justify-content:flex-start;font-size:1.8rem;padding:1.5rem 2.2rem;padding-inline-start:0;border-bottom:0}.menu-drawer__topbar .menu-drawer__menu-item:before{content:"";height:2rem;border-inline-start:.1rem solid rgb(var(--color-border));padding-inline-end:1.5rem}.menu-drawer__utility-links{display:flex;align-items:center;justify-content:space-between;padding:2rem;border-top:.1rem solid rgb(var(--color-border))}.menu-drawer .list-social:empty{display:none}.js details[open]>.menu-drawer [data-animate]{opacity:0;transform:translate(-4rem);transition-property:transform,opacity;transition-timing-function:ease;transition-duration:var(--duration-long)}.js details[open]>.menu-drawer [data-animate-delay-1]{transition-delay:var(--duration-default)}.js details[open]>.menu-drawer [data-animate-delay-2]{transition-delay:calc(var(--duration-default) + .1s)}.js details[open].menu-opening>.menu-drawer [data-animate],.no-js details[open]>.menu-drawer [data-animate]{opacity:1;transform:translate(0)}@keyframes left-to-right{0%{transform:translate(0)}25%{opacity:0;transform:translate(100%)}50%{opacity:0;transform:translate(-100%)}75%{opacity:1;transform:translate(0)}}@keyframes right-to-left{0%{transform:translate(0)}25%{opacity:0;transform:translate(-100%)}50%{opacity:0;transform:translate(100%)}75%{opacity:1;transform:translate(0)}}.menu-accordion-trigger{cursor:pointer}.menu-accordion-trigger svg{transition:transform .25s}.menu-accordion-trigger.open svg{transform:rotate(0)}.menu-accordion-content{overflow:hidden;top:0;left:0;width:100%;z-index:10;height:0;background-color:rgb(var(--colors_submenu_bg_mb));transition:height .5s}.menu-accordion-content.menu-opening{height:auto}.menu-drawer summary .icon-caret,.menu-drawer .summary .icon-caret{transform:rotate(-90deg)}.menu-drawer__back{padding:15px 18px;line-height:normal}.menu-drawer__back .icon-caret{width:16px;height:16px;transform:rotate(90deg)}.menu-drawer__third-lv{width:100%;height:0;z-index:12;background-color:rgb(var(--colors_submenu_bg_mb));transition:height .5s;overflow-y:auto}.menu-drawer__third-lv .list-menu{margin-top:16px}.menu-drawer__third-lv.menu-opening{height:auto}.html-menu-drawer-open{overflow:hidden}.menu-drawer__submenu-header{display:flex;align-items:center;padding:1.5rem 2rem;border-bottom:1px solid var(--color-grey-200);background-color:rgb(var(--color-background))}.menu-drawer__back-button{font:var(--h6-font-mobile);letter-spacing:var(--h6-letter-spacing);text-transform:uppercase;display:flex;align-items:center;background:none;border:none;padding:0;cursor:pointer;text-decoration:none;color:inherit}.menu-drawer__back-button .icon-caret{transform:rotate(90deg);margin-right:1rem;width:var(--icon-size-l);height:var(--icon-size-l)}@media screen and (max-width: 749px){.menu-drawer__promo-wrapper{display:flex;overflow-x:auto;white-space:nowrap;max-width:100%;margin:0 var(--space-md)}.menu-drawer__promo-wrapper .menu-drawer__promo{flex:0 0 auto;margin-right:var(--space-sm);width:260px}.menu-drawer__promo-wrapper .menu-drawer__promo:last-child{margin-right:0}}@media screen and (max-width: 749px){.menu-drawer__icons--wrapper{padding:var(--space-sm) var(--space-md) 0;border-top:1px solid var(--color-grey-200);margin-top:var(--space-2xl)}.menu-drawer__icons--wrapper .menu-drawer__icon{line-height:140%;padding:var(--space-xs) 0}.menu-drawer__icons--wrapper .menu-drawer__icon .header__search{line-height:140%}.menu-drawer__icons--wrapper .menu-drawer__icon .header__heading-link{color:rgb(var(--color-header-foreground));padding:0;justify-self:left}.menu-drawer__icons--wrapper .menu-drawer__icon .header__icon:not(.header__icon--summary),.menu-drawer__icons--wrapper .menu-drawer__icon .header__icon span:not(.cart-count-bubble){display:block;text-transform:none}}.menu-drawer__submenu-content{padding:2rem}.menu-drawer__submenu-list{list-style:none;padding:0;margin:0}@media screen and (max-width: 749px){.menu-drawer__submenu-list.list-menu--columns-2{display:grid;grid-template-columns:repeat(2,1fr)}}.menu-drawer__submenu-item{display:flex;align-items:center;padding:1.5rem 0;text-decoration:none;border-bottom:.1rem solid rgba(var(--color-border),.1)}.menu-drawer__submenu-item:last-child{border-bottom:none}.menu-drawer__submenu-item .media{width:6rem;height:6rem;margin-right:1.5rem;border-radius:.5rem;overflow:hidden;flex-shrink:0}.menu-drawer__submenu-item .media img{width:100%;height:100%;object-fit:cover}.menu-drawer__submenu-item span{flex:1}.menu-drawer__submenu-item .icon-caret{margin-left:auto;transform:rotate(-90deg);width:1.6rem;height:1.6rem}.menu-drawer__submenu-item-wrapper{width:100%}.menu-drawer__submenu-item-wrapper .menu-drawer__submenu-item{cursor:pointer;background:none;border:none;width:100%;text-align:left;font-family:inherit}@media screen and (max-width: 749px){.js .menu-drawer__submenu{position:fixed;top:0;left:0;width:100vw;height:100vh;z-index:1000}.menu-drawer__submenu-header{padding:2rem;background-color:var(--color-brand-background-dark)}.menu-drawer__submenu-content{padding:2rem;height:calc(100vh - 80px);overflow-y:auto;background-color:rgb(var(--colors_sidebar_menu_bg_mb))}.menu-drawer__submenu-item{padding:var(--space-sm) 0}.menu-drawer__submenu-item .media{width:8rem;height:8rem}}.menu-drawer__submenu{will-change:transform}.menu-drawer__submenu.active{overflow:hidden}
/*# sourceMappingURL=/cdn/shop/t/197/assets/component-menu-drawer.css.map */
